It’s amazing how much scrap metal we throw away on a daily basis. Instead of paying a trash hauler to dump your scrap in a landfill, we can “turn your trash into cash”. Metal for Meals helps to fund the food pantry at St. Mary Church on the near-west side of Grand Rapids.
This semi-annual Metal for Meals food pantry fundraiser recycles metal: copper, aluminum, iron, steel, lead, wire, brass, etc. Unusable household items like washing machines, dryers, rakes, garden tools, irons, siding, bikes, grills, tin cans, file cabinets, tire rims, microwaves, bed frames, wire, pipes, machinery, motors, etc., can all be donated to this great cause.
